How to Update Receiver Firmware & Configuration for New AES Encrypted RTX Beam
print icon

A video showing how to upgrade the firmware and change the RTX satellite frequency on an R10 receiver, to enable the use of the new AES encrypted RTX correction stream. This update is required for the continued use of the xFill service. The same procedure applies to the R10, R10-2, R9s and R2 GNSS receiver.
